1. 下载安装包 http://www.linuxvirtualserver.or ... sadm-1.24-6.src.rpm 注:找适合自己内核版本的 2. 使用命令rpmbuild --rebuild ipvsadm-1.24-6.src.rpm 注:rpmbuild没有的话,需要自己安装rpm-build-4.4.2-48.el5.i386.rpm #rpmbuild --rebuild ipvsadm-1.24-6.src.rpm 注:会提示有警告和错误 忽略 3. vi /usr/src/redhat/SPECS/ipvsadm.spec 将第7行Copyright修改为License 保存退出 4. 建立软连接ln -s /usr/src/kernels/2.6.18-92.el5-i686/ /usr/src/linux,注意源目录地址。 #ln -s /usr/src/kernels/2.6.18-92.el5-i686/ /usr/src/linux 注:如果/usr/src/下没有kernels目录,需要安装kernel-devel-2.6.18-92.el5.i686.rpm 5. 生成二进制安装包 #rpmbuild -ba /usr/src/redhat/SPECS/ipvsadm.spec 6. 安装ipvsadm #rpm -ivh /usr/src/redhat/RPMS/i386/ipvsadm-1.24-6.i386.rpm Service ipvsadm start会报错 [root@localhost ~]# /etc/init.d/ipvsadm start Clearing the current IPVS table: [确定] Applying IPVS configuration: /etc/init.d/ipvsadm: line 62: /etc/sysconfig/ipvsadm: 没有那个文件或目录 注:遇到这个错误。运行service ipvsadm save。之后再执行service ipvsadm start |
通过rpm方式安装ipsvadm
最新推荐文章于 2021-01-28 18:42:40 发布